v0.12.4: 安全豁免 + 搜索质量 + 上下文管控 + 版本纪律 Cleanup

Fix:
- 工作空间路径安全豁免 — AppData 拦截自相矛盾,tree/list_directory 恢复正常
- 搜索自动抓取硬上限 MAX_AUTO_FETCH=8,防止上下文爆炸 132%
- 搜索结果相关性过滤 — 跳过 Canva/ChatGPT 等无关条目
- 浏览器回退 LRU 缓存 — 同 URL 10min 内不再重复渲染
- Plan Mode 任务描述固化到系统提示词 — 压缩后不丢失目标
- ephemeral 清理时机优化 — 高负载时跳过,避免 Plan 进度丢失

Refactor:
- 全项目 v0.12.0 → v0.12.4 版本号同步(7 文件)
- 版本号纪律:仅 5 白名单文件保留版本号,其余 14 源码全部清除
- docs/DEVELOPMENT.md 据实重写(目录/架构/规范/SearXNG/Harness)
- SearXNG 抓取条数输入框改为 min=1 max=8 数字框
- 代码注释中的版本标记全部移除,仅描述功能
